The Pressing Challenges at TechNova

Before SunQit's intervention, TechNova's assembly line faced four critical pain points that eroded efficiency and profitability:

1. Wasted Time on Material Handling

Workers had to walk 7-12 meters to retrieve parts from static steel racks, adding 2.5 minutes per unit to production time. For a factory producing 1,200 units daily, this translated to 3,000 minutes (50 hours) of wasted labor weekly—costing an estimated $18,000 monthly in lost productivity.

2. Costly Static Damage

Non-ESD workbenches caused static buildup that ruined 60-70 sensitive microchips monthly. Each defective component cost $60 to replace, leading to $3,600-$4,200 in unnecessary waste. Moreover, rework for these defects took 10-15 hours weekly, further delaying production.

3. Inflexible Racks and Conveyors

TechNova's fixed steel racks and belt conveyors couldn't adapt to new product lines. When launching a new smartwatch model, they spent two weeks rebuilding racks from scratch—costing $12,000 in materials and lost revenue due to delayed market entry.

4. Noisy and Unreliable Conveyors

Old belt conveyors jammed 3-4 times daily, causing 20-minute delays each. Maintenance teams spent 12 hours weekly fixing these issues, adding $6,000 to monthly operational costs. The constant noise also reduced worker focus and morale.

SunQit's Custom Lean Solution

SunQit's team conducted a 4-day on-site assessment, interviewing staff, observing workflows, and mapping production bottlenecks. They designed a modular, adaptive solution centered on the 38mm White Aluminum Roller Track, paired with five key components:

1. 38mm White Aluminum Roller Track

This track was the backbone of the system. Its lightweight aluminum construction (1.2mm thickness) made it easy to install and reconfigure, while its corrosion-resistant surface ensured long-term durability. The smooth rollers reduced friction by 80%, allowing parts bins to glide effortlessly. The white finish also simplified cleanliness checks—workers could quickly spot dirt or debris, maintaining a hygienic environment.

2. Flow Racks with Roller Track Integration

SunQit's flow racks used the 38mm roller track to enable first-in-first-out (FIFO) inventory management. Bins of parts slid from the back to the front of the rack, eliminating the need for workers to lift heavy containers. Adjustable shelves accommodated different part sizes, and aluminum profile accessories allowed quick height adjustments.

3. Modular Roller Conveyors

The modular conveyors integrated seamlessly with the roller track flow racks. They were easy to connect and reposition, so TechNova could adjust the conveyor path in hours instead of days. Unlike belt conveyors, these systems were quiet (under 60 dB) and jam-resistant—cutting maintenance time by 90%.

4. ESD Workbenches

Each workstation was upgraded to an ESD workbench with a static-dissipative surface and grounded legs. This eliminated static buildup, protecting sensitive microchips from damage. The workbenches also featured adjustable heights (75-90 cm) to reduce worker fatigue and back strain.

5. Aluminum Profile Accessories

SunQit used aluminum profile accessories (adjustable joints, clamps, and brackets) to customize the system. These parts allowed TechNova to modify rack heights, conveyor angles, and workstation layouts without specialized tools—supporting continuous improvement and product line changes.

Transformative Results: 30% Productivity Boost

Three months post-implementation, TechNova saw dramatic improvements across all key metrics. The 30% productivity increase was driven by three core gains:

1. 70% Reduction in Material Handling Time

Flow racks and conveyors brought parts directly to workstations, cutting material handling time from 2.5 minutes to 45 seconds per unit. This saved 2,160 minutes (36 hours) weekly, accounting for 15% of the productivity boost.

2. 95% drop in Static Defects

ESD workbenches reduced static damage from 60-70 units monthly to just 3-4 units. This eliminated $3,600-$4,200 in monthly waste and 10-15 hours of rework—contributing 10% to the productivity increase.

3. 85% Faster Line Changeover

Modular components allowed TechNova to reconfigure the assembly line for new products in 2 days (down from 2 weeks). This enabled faster market entry and reduced lost revenue—adding 5% to the productivity gain.

The following table summarizes the quantifiable results:

Metric Before Implementation After Implementation Improvement
Material Handling Time per Unit 2.5 mins 45 secs 70% reduction
Static Defect Rate 5.8% 0.3% 95% reduction
Line Changeover Time 14 days 2 days 85% reduction
Monthly Production Volume 36,000 units 46,800 units 30% increase
Monthly Maintenance Cost $6,000 $600 90% reduction
